Rental Market Driven by Community, Culture, and Over 200 Nationalities Living in the City
Dubai, UAE, 20th November 2025: Dubai’s position as a truly global city, where people from all backgrounds live and work, has been highlighted in a new market report released today.
The report by fäm Properties shows Dubai as a city made up of many smaller communities, with the rental market divided to suit different nationalities. This allows residents to choose areas that match their culture, budget, and daily needs.
Data from DXBinteract reveals clear patterns in tenant demographics. For example, Al Warsan First and Jebel Ali First have mostly South Asian tenants. In Al Warsan First, 34% of tenants are Indian, 25% Pakistani, and 10% Chinese. In Jebel Ali First, 52% are Indian, with 12% from the Philippines.
On the other hand, areas like Jumeirah First, Al Wasl, and Dubai Creek Harbour have more European residents. Jumeirah First has 18% Russian tenants, with UK, France, Germany, and Italy making up another 34%. In Al Wasl, 15% of renters are from the UK, 10% from France, and 10% from Russia. At Dubai Creek Harbour, Russia accounts for 11%, the UK 10%, and France 9%.
Overall, Indian and British nationals are the largest tenant groups in Dubai, which is home to 203 nationalities. Indians are the top nationality in five out of ten key areas: Al Warsan First, Jebel Ali First, JVC, Al Barsha Fourth, Business Bay, and Jebel Ali First. British tenants rank in the top five in eight of the ten areas, leading in Al Yelayiss 1 with 26% of tenants.
Among Arab expatriates, Lebanese and Egyptians are the largest groups. Lebanese feature in the top five nationalities in five areas, including Business Bay, JVC, and Al Barsha Fourth, while Egyptians are prominent in four areas, including JVC, Al Barsha South Fourth, and Jebel Ali First.
“Another interesting finding is the size of the ‘Others’ category,” said Firas Al Msaddi, CEO of fäm Properties. “In areas like Business Bay (40%), Dubai Creek Harbour (42%), and Al Wasl (40%), this group is the largest single segment. This shows how diverse and global Dubai really is.”
“The data confirms that while certain nationalities live in clusters, Dubai as a whole is made up of many international communities. The rental market is about more than prices—it’s about culture, community, and how over 200 nationalities call this city home.”
